recognize and execute dynamically linked executables
. generalize libexec slightly to get some more necessary information from ELF files, e.g. the interpreter . execute dynamically linked executables when exec()ed by VFS . switch to netbsd variant of elf32.h exclusively, solves some conflicting headers
